Joanne Shaw Taylor looks back on lost love with ‘The Girl That You Loved Before’
Joanne Shaw Taylor looks back on changing relationships in new single “The Girl That You Loved Before”, taken from upcoming album The Trouble With Love.
Joanne Shaw Taylor has released “The Girl That You Loved Before”, the latest single from her forthcoming studio album The Trouble With Love, which is due on 23 October via Journeyman Records.
The British blues-rock artist has also released an official video for the track. Moving between performance footage and scenes of Taylor alone in a dimly lit bar, the video reflects the song’s focus on memory, changing relationships and the distance that can develop between two people who were once close.
Musically, “The Girl That You Loved Before” pairs Taylor’s vocal with a steady, melodic arrangement before opening out into a prominent guitar solo. Its lyrics look back at a past relationship from the perspective of someone considering how much both people — and their memories of each other — may have changed.
“This song came from looking back at past relationships and realising how much we change over time,” Joanne shares. “It’s about being remembered for who you were, not necessarily who you are now. I wrote it to explore that nostalgia, that longing, and the bittersweet ache it brings.”
The song is the latest preview of The Trouble With Love, which was produced by Kevin Shirley. Previous tracks from the album include its title song, featuring Joe Bonamassa, and “What Good Is My Love?”, featuring Orianthi, alongside “Hell Or High Water”, “This Is Who I Am”, “Tired Of Being Right” and “Bad Boy”.
The ten-track album also includes “Never Gonna Please ‘Em All”, “You And Me (Rachel’s Song)” and “Death Wish”.
Taylor is also continuing her US live schedule ahead of the album’s release, with shows in Michigan, Ohio and Kentucky during September. A further US run begins at Albuquerque’s KiMo Theatre on 28 October and continues through November, with Bywater Call appearing on selected dates before Robert Jon & The Wreck join the later part of the tour.
